Servings: 10
Prep Time: 30 minutes
Difficulty: Medium
Kashrus: Dairy
Ingredients:
2 Tbsp olive oil (for frying)
1 small onion, finely diced
1 cup canned or 4 fresh mushrooms, diced
1 cup (250g) 5% cream cheese
¾ cup (150g) grated feta or other salty cheese
¾ cup (150g) grated mozzarella or cheddar
2 heaping Tbsp all-purpose flour
Pinch of kosher salt
Pinch of black pepper
1 tsp dried basil or oregano (optional)
For Coating:
1 large egg
1 cup golden breadcrumbs
Instructions:
1.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Sauté the onion until golden, then add mushrooms and cook until caramelized. Set aside to cool slightly, draining excess oil.
2. In a large bowl, combine the cooled mushroom-onion mix with cream cheese, feta, mozzarella, flour, salt, pepper, and optional herbs. Mix until smooth.
3. Shape the mixture into small, falafel-sized balls.
4. Freeze the balls for 2 hours (or until ready to serve) to firm them up.
5. Set up two plates: one with a beaten egg and one with breadcrumbs. Dip each ball in the egg, then roll in breadcrumbs to coat evenly.
6. Deep-fry in hot oil until golden and crispy, about 2-3 minutes. Serve hot for maximum meltiness.
Serving Tip: Pair with a creamy garlic dip or a tangy marinara sauce for an extra flavor kick.
